The Victorian Timber Innovation Grants Program is proving grants for native timber industry businesses to explore, invest and implement opportunities to support their transition under the Victorian Forestry Plan.
Objectives
- To assist businesses directly affected by the Victorian Forestry Plan to:
- explore, investigate, and implement business transition opportunities
- undertake capital investment in business transition projects
- diversify and reorientate core business activities to support alternative employment opportunities
- develop and implement downstream manufacturing opportunities using alternative fibre
- invest in new opportunities to process or manufacture using plantation timber feedstock and/or alternative fibre.
Funding Information
- The Victorian Timber Innovation Grants Program will provide grants of up to $1 million.
- Grants over $1 million may be considered for projects that generate a significant number of jobs and local community benefit.
Eligibility Criteria
- Applications for a Victorian Timber Innovation Grants Program grant are invited from businesses that:
- hold a current VicForests Timber Sale Agreement, or
- hold a Forest Produce Licence issued by VicForests, or
- are a timber harvest and / or haulage business with a current VicForests contract or agreement, or
- are a harvest and/or haulage sub-contractor to a business with a current VicForests harvest and/or haulage contract with at least 70 per cent of its annual revenue derived from the business with the VicForests contract, based on the 2020-21 financial year
- a seed collector with a contract with VicForests with at least 70 per cent of its annual revenue derived from the VicForests contract, based on the 2020-21 financial year
- have an Australian Business Number (ABN)
- conduct business operations within Victoria
- meet all the industrial relations obligations as an employer in accordance with the National Employment Standards under the Fair Work Act 2009 (Cth).
- Eligible businesses are encouraged (not mandatory) to participate in the Forestry Business Transition Voucher Program to support their application.
- Sawmill businesses participating in the Victorian Forestry Plan Opt-Out Scheme are eligible to submit an application to the Victorian Timber Innovation Grants Program.
